Transaction 88e1559be1e71bf7c3da17e3d07c83a4e932011820f52eca80c1d628ba7ce79a

1 Input
2 Outputs
  • 88e1559be1e71bf7c3da17e3d07c83a4e932011820f52eca80c1d628ba7ce79a:0
  • value  269540000
    address  36pr66iL3we6dt7Q9CpFfg53x9R9QDkbhf
  • 88e1559be1e71bf7c3da17e3d07c83a4e932011820f52eca80c1d628ba7ce79a:1
  • value  78687688086
    address  1Mt944tVLqYrtz6ncDXQfG3qxHAZHsyPLJ